4.1. The Website will open for Entries from December 6th, 2018 and close on March 10th, 2019 at 23:59 CET (the “Expiry Date”). The Company will not accept Entries submitted after the Expiry Date.
4.2. In March 2019, a technical committee, with different skills and specializations, having the qualifications to evaluate the different types of projects shall select the best projects which proceed to the second phase of the Prize (the “Second Phase”). The projects shall be evaluated with the following parameters: function, shape, innovation and environmental impact.
4.3 The communication of the evaluation will be sent by email to the address updated by the entrant in the application form within the timeline indications.
4.4 The selected Prototypes will be exposed during the show “Milano Design Week 8-14 Aprile 2019” (“FuoriSalone 2019”) at “Galleria Rossana Orlandi” (the “Show”).
4.5. In the Second Phase, during the Show, the best 4 projects will be selected, one for each category. On April 7th, 2019, a Jury represented by a team of international experts will announce the 4 winners of the Prize (the “Winners”).
4.6. Each Winner will be awarded with Eur 10,000.00 (to the entrant or as applicable the team) and with a Ro Plastic Prize certificate.
4.7. All monetary prizes shall be paid in euros into the bank account(s) nominated by the Winners within 60 days since prize Winners have been announced. Where a monetary prize is payable to a team, the Company will pay the amount due into the nominated bank account and will have no responsibility for dividing such amount between team members.
